Located around 40 kms (25 miles) from central Stockholm, ARN can be reached in about 35 minutes by car, depending on traffic. The journey by public transport takes roughly 40 minutes.

Bromma Airport (BMA)
You can arrive at BMA from the centre of Stockholm in about 20 minutes by car, depending on traffic. The ride on public transport will take roughly 55 minutes to cover the 10 kms (6 miles) or so.

Stockholm Skavsta Airport (NYO)
Whether just for an hour or two or a handful of days, a stopover can make your entire trip feel a little less stressful. When jetting out of Stockholm Skavsta Airport (NYO), you can book a plane ticket from Stockholm to Malta International Airport (MLA) stopping at Frederic Chopin Airport (WAW).
From the centre of Stockholm, NYO is around 105 kms (65 miles) away. It'll take you roughly 1 hour 20 minutes to get to the airport by car and 1 hour 50 minutes or so on public transport.

The best time to fly from Stockholm to Malta International Airport (MLA)
It's time to work out your travel dates for your flight from Stockholm to Malta International Airport (MLA). August is the peak month for travel to Valletta. If you prefer a quieter vibe, go in April.
The warmest month in Valletta is August, with temperatures ranging between 25ºC (77ºF) and 30ºC (86ºF). Lock in your Stockholm to MLA plane ticket then if that's your definition of good weather.
Search for cheap tickets from Stockholm to Malta International Airport in February if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 11ºC (52ºF) and 16ºC (61ºF).
